Output 26db5b1fc05e3a72277bda2dafb4cfd99267df92f00fad8a98392cd5766c2164:2

value
659113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ea971a20c3a52ca4a3c21543a85a42e32037b5 OP_EQUAL
address
3NvZifUeNERUKMPf4tSybifzbd8TtUuwzh
transaction
26db5b1fc05e3a72277bda2dafb4cfd99267df92f00fad8a98392cd5766c2164
spent
true